MySQL je považován za nejpopulárnější systém pro správu databází, ale pokročilí uživatelé vědí, že v poslední době se vývoj tohoto nástroje rozdělil na dvě části, což nakonec vedlo ke vzniku nového řešení s názvem MariaDB. Mnoho lidí nyní dává přednost tomuto konkrétnímu systému DBMS z různých důvodů, kterými se dnes nebudeme zabývat, protože naším hlavním cílem je demonstrovat, jak se instalace této komponenty v CentOS 7 provádí pomocí příkladu průvodce krok za krokem.
Nainstalujte MariaDB na CentOS 7
Pokud byla instalace systému pro správu databáze MariaDB možná prostřednictvím standardních úložišť OS, byl by tento článek co nejkratší. Vývojáři se však vydali trochu jinou cestou, což způsobuje některé nové výzvy a potíže. Podstata metody spočívá v tom, že soubor úložiště uživatel ručně sbírá a poté stáhne balíčky. O tom si promluvíme ve druhém kroku, ale nyní se pusťme do přípravných prací.
Krok 1: Předběžné kroky
Na oficiálním webu budete muset zvolit sestavu CentOS a někteří uživatelé takové informace nemají, takže první úkol, který by měl být dokončen, je určit aktuální verzi operačního systému. Na našem webu je samostatný článek, který vám umožní zvládnout daný úkol. Přečtěte si jej podle níže uvedeného odkazu a implementujte jednu z uvedených metod.
Více informací: Určení verze CentOS
Nyní přejdeme k samotnému webu. Jak již bylo zmíněno dříve, bude použito k vytvoření jeho konfiguračního souboru za účelem stažení balíčků. Chcete-li získat správný kód, musíte provést následující:
Přejít na oficiální stránky MariaDB
- Postupujte podle výše uvedeného odkazu a vyberte ze seznamu „CentOS“.
- Zobrazí se druhý sloupec. Zde definujte vydání kliknutím na příslušný řádek.
- Zbývá pouze označit verzi, kterou jsme se dříve naučili.
- Obdržíte tabulku s kódem a pokyny k instalaci, ale začátečník nemusí tomu všemu rozumět.
Pokud jste pomocí tabulky zjistili princip instalace sami, přejděte přímo ke konfiguraci, přeskočte druhý krok a nezkušeným uživatelům doporučujeme věnovat pozornost následujícímu průvodci.
Krok 2: Vytvořte soubor a nainstalujte MariaDB
Jak již víte, musíte nejprve vytvořit samotný soubor umístěním na speciální místo v místním úložišti. Pak zbývá jen zadat příkaz a potvrdit všechny vaše akce. Podrobněji tento postup vypadá takto:
- Spusťte konzolu pohodlnou metodou, například prostřednictvím nabídky aplikace.
- Zde doporučujeme nainstalovat pohodlný textový editor, aby nedocházelo k problémům s ukládáním souboru. Enter
sudo yum install nano
a stiskněte klávesu Enter. - Tato akce se provádí jménem superuživatele, takže budete muset účet potvrdit napsáním hesla. Všimněte si, že znaky zadané tímto způsobem se na řetězci neobjeví.
- Přijměte instalaci, nebo pokud již bylo do systému přidáno nano, pokračujte dalším krokem.
- Enter
sudo nano /etc/yum.repos.d/Mariadb.repo
k vytvoření nového souboru úložiště v požadovaném umístění. - Okamžitě se otevře textový editor, který vám umožní ověřit, že soubor byl právě vytvořen právě teď.
- Vložte obsah, který jste získali z oficiálního webu MariaDB.
- Uložte změny pomocí klávesové zkratky Ctrl + O.
- Když se objeví nový řádek, není třeba měnit umístění ani název, stačí kliknout na Enter.
- Poté opusťte textový editor pomocí Ctrl + X.
- Vložte následující příkaz
sudo yum nainstalujte MariaDB-server MariaDB-klienta
a potvrďte to. - Počkejte, až se všechny archivy přenesou do vašeho počítače.
- Zobrazí se řádek upozorňující na instalaci balíčku. Potvrďte akci výběrem možnosti y.
- Dále bude vytvořen veřejný klíč, který slouží k přístupu do systému správy databáze. Přečtěte si informace a počkejte na konec instalace.
Instalace skončila.Jediné, co musíte udělat, je nastavit počáteční konfiguraci, abyste se ujistili, že přístroj funguje normálně. Naše závěrečná fáze bude věnována této operaci.
Krok 3: Počáteční konfigurace
Účelem této fáze není poskytnout návod na úplnou správnou konfiguraci systému DBMS, protože to vše je subjektivní a závisí na použitých dalších komponentách. Nyní navrhujeme pouze aktivovat službu a zajistit standardní pravidla zabezpečení paralelním nastavením hesla root.
- V "Terminál" zapsat
sudo systemctl start mariadb
ke spuštění služby MariaDB. - Přijměte tuto operaci pomocí hesla superuživatele.
- Pokud jste obdrželi informace o nepřítomnosti souboru, znamená to, že aktuální verze systému DBMS byla nainstalována před předchozí. Budeme muset vložit příkaz
mv /etc/systemd/system/mariadb.service {, bak}
a pak začít znovu. - Použití
sudo mysql_upgrade
k aktualizaci tabulek, pokud je nástroj nainstalován přes starou verzi. - Zbývá pouze stanovit standardní pravidla na ochranu systému před hackerstvím. K tomu se používá
sudo mysql_secure_installation
. - Podle zobrazených pokynů vytvořte nové heslo a základní pravidla zabezpečení.
Navrhujeme zjistit všechny ostatní konfigurační body MariaDB v oficiální dokumentaci. Vývojáři poskytují mnoho užitečných příkazů a kódů, které vám pomohou vytvořit optimální systém správy databáze a postarat se o jeho zabezpečení.
Přejít na oficiální dokumentaci MariaDB
Nyní víte, že instalace MariaDB je obtížnější než obvyklé programy, ale stále docela proveditelná i bez dalších znalostí a dovedností. Zbývá pouze postupovat podle daných pokynů a prostudovat si dokumentaci, abyste se s tímto DBMS seznámili.
Přečtěte si také:
Instalace phpMyAdmin na CentOS 7
Instalace PHP 7 na CentOS 7